Skip to content

+EA 23.250 Nightly Patch 1 - Plugin.BaseCore

December 20, 2025

1 file modified.

Important Changes

Possible breaking changes. Click the filename to view the chunk.

Lang (1)

cs
public static string[] GetDialog(string idSheet, string idTopic) 
public static ExcelData.Sheet GetDialogSheet(string idSheet) 

Lang

public static string _ChangeNum(int prev, int now)

cs
		return prev + " ⇒ " + now;
	}

	public static string[] GetDialog(string idSheet, string idTopic) 
	public static ExcelData.Sheet GetDialogSheet(string idSheet) 
	{
		if (excelDialog == null)
		{

public static string[] GetDialog(string idSheet, string idTopic)

cs
			excelDialog.path = path;
		}
		excelDialog.BuildMap(idSheet);
		ExcelData.Sheet sheet = excelDialog.sheets[idSheet]; 
		return excelDialog.sheets[idSheet]; 
	} 
	public static string[] GetDialog(string idSheet, string idTopic) 
	{ 
		ExcelData.Sheet dialogSheet = GetDialogSheet(idSheet); 
		string key = "text" + (isBuiltin ? ("_" + langCode) : "");
		Dictionary<string, string> dictionary = sheet.map.TryGetValue(idTopic); 
		Dictionary<string, string> dictionary = dialogSheet.map.TryGetValue(idTopic); 
		if (dictionary == null || !dictionary.ContainsKey(key))
		{
			return new string[1] { idTopic };